Franchise Brand Manager: The Role and Responsibilities
In the world of franchising, the franchise brand manager plays a crucial role in ensuring the success and growth of a franchise system. A franchise brand manager is responsible for overseeing the brand strategy, marketing, and operations of a franchise system to ensure consistent brand messaging and high-quality customer experiences.
Here’s a breakdown of the role and responsibilities:
1. Develop and Implement Brand Strategy
They are responsible for developing and implementing the brand strategy for the franchise system. This includes defining the brand’s values, mission, vision, and positioning. They also develop and manage the brand’s visual identity, including logos, color schemes, and brand guidelines.
2. Manage Marketing and Advertising Efforts
The franchise brand manager oversees all marketing and advertising efforts for the franchise system. This includes developing and executing marketing campaigns, managing social media channels, and creating promotional materials such as brochures, flyers, and ads. They also work closely with franchisees to ensure they are adhering to the brand’s marketing guidelines and messaging.
3. Train and Support Franchisees
A franchise brand manager is responsible for training and supporting franchisees to ensure they understand and adhere to the brand’s standards and guidelines. They provide ongoing training and support to franchisees to ensure they are delivering a consistent customer experience across all locations.
4. Manage Operations and Customer Experience
They oversee the operations and customer experience for the franchise system. They work closely with franchisees to ensure they are providing high-quality products and services that align with the brand’s values and standards. They also monitor customer feedback and work to improve the customer experience across all locations.
5. Ensure Compliance with Legal and Regulatory Requirements
They are responsible for ensuring compliance with all legal and regulatory requirements related to the franchise system. This includes monitoring franchisee compliance with the franchise agreement, managing franchisee relationships, and ensuring compliance with state and federal laws.
In conclusion, the franchise brand manager is a critical role in the success and growth of a franchise system. They are responsible for developing and implementing the brand strategy, managing marketing and advertising efforts, training and supporting franchisees, managing operations and customer experience, and ensuring compliance with legal and regulatory requirements. A skilled franchise brand manager can help a franchise system achieve its goals and succeed in a competitive marketplace.